Rollup merge of #127921 - spastorino:stabilize-unsafe-extern-blocks, r=compiler-errors
Stabilize unsafe extern blocks (RFC 3484)

# Stabilization report

## Summary

This is a tracking issue for the RFC 3484: Unsafe Extern Blocks

We are stabilizing `#![feature(unsafe_extern_blocks)]`, as described in [Unsafe Extern Blocks RFC 3484](https://github.com/rust-lang/rfcs/pull/3484). This feature makes explicit that declaring an extern block is unsafe. Starting in Rust 2024, all extern blocks must be marked as unsafe. In all editions, items within unsafe extern blocks may be marked as safe to use.

RFC: https://github.com/rust-lang/rfcs/pull/3484
Tracking issue: #123743

## What is stabilized

### Summary of stabilization

We now need extern blocks to be marked as unsafe and items inside can also have safety modifiers (unsafe or safe), by default items with no modifiers are unsafe to offer easy migration without surprising results.

```rust
unsafe extern {
    // sqrt (from libm) may be called with any `f64`
    pub safe fn sqrt(x: f64) -> f64;

    // strlen (from libc) requires a valid pointer,
    // so we mark it as being an unsafe fn
    pub unsafe fn strlen(p: *const c_char) -> usize;

    // this function doesn't say safe or unsafe, so it defaults to unsafe
    pub fn free(p: *mut core::ffi::c_void);

    pub safe static IMPORTANT_BYTES: [u8; 256];

    pub safe static LINES: SyncUnsafeCell<i32>;
}
```

Rollup merge of #128453 - RalfJung:raw_eq, r=saethlin
raw_eq: using it on bytes with provenance is not UB (outside const-eval)

The current behavior of raw_eq violates provenance monotonicity. See https://github.com/rust-lang/rust/pull/124921 for an explanation of provenance monotonicity. It is violated in raw_eq because comparing bytes without provenance is well-defined, but adding provenance makes the operation UB.

So remove the no-provenance requirement from raw_eq. However, the requirement stays in-place for compile-time invocations of raw_eq, that indeed cannot deal with provenance.

Rollup merge of #128443 - compiler-errors:async-unreachable, r=fmease
Properly mark loop as diverging if it has no breaks

Due to specifics about the desugaring of the `.await` operator, HIR typeck doesn't recognize that `.await`ing an `impl Future<Output = !>` will diverge in the same way as calling a `fn() -> !`.

This is because the await operator desugars to approximately:

```rust
loop {
    match future.poll(...) {
        Poll::Ready(x) => break x,
        Poll::Pending => {}
    }
}
```

We know that the value of `x` is `!`, however since `break` is a coercion site, we coerce `!` to some `?0` (the type of the loop expression). Then since the type of the `loop {...}` expression is `?0`, we will not detect the loop as diverging like we do with other expressions that evaluate to `!`:

0b5eb7ba7b/compiler/rustc_hir_typeck/src/expr.rs (L240-L243)

We can technically fix this in two ways:
1. Make coercion of loop exprs more eagerly result in a type of `!` when the only break expressions have type `!`.
2. Make loops understand that all of that if they have only diverging break values, then the loop diverges as well.

(1.) likely has negative effects on inference, and seems like a weird special case to drill into coercion. However, it turns out that (2.) is very easy to implement, we already record whether a loop has any break expressions, and when we do so, we actually skip over any break expressions with diverging values!:

0b5eb7ba7b/compiler/rustc_hir_typeck/src/expr.rs (L713-L716)

Thus, we can consider the loop as diverging if we see that it has no breaks, which is the change implemented in this PR.

This is not usually a problem in regular code for two reasons:
1. In regular code, we already mark `break diverging()` as unreachable if `diverging()` is unreachable. We don't do this for `.await`, since we suppress unreachable errors within `.await` (#64930). Un-suppressing this code will result in spurious unreachable expression errors pointing to internal await machinery.
3. In loops that truly have no breaks (e.g. `loop {}`), we already evaluate the type of the loop to `!`, so this special case is kinda moot. This only affects loops that have `break`s with values of type `!`.

Thus, this seems like a change that may affect more code than just `.await`, but it likely does not in meaningful ways; if it does, it's certainly correct to apply.

Rollup merge of #128151 - estebank:missing-extern-crate, r=petrochenkov
Structured suggestion for `extern crate foo` when `foo` isn't resolved in import

When encountering a name in an import that could have come from a crate that wasn't imported, use a structured suggestion to suggest `extern crate foo;` pointing at the right place in the crate.

When encountering `_` in an import, do not suggest `extern crate _;`.

```
error[E0432]: unresolved import `spam`
  --> $DIR/import-from-missing-star-3.rs:2:9
   |
LL |     use spam::*;
   |         ^^^^ maybe a missing crate `spam`?
   |
help: consider importing the `spam` crate
   |
LL + extern crate spam;
   |
```

0b5eb7ba7b Auto merge of #127513 - nikic:llvm-19, r=cuviper
Update to LLVM 19

The LLVM 19.1.0 final release is planned for Sep 3rd. The rustc 1.82 stable release will be on Oct 17th.

The unstable MC/DC coverage support is temporarily broken by this update. It will be restored by https://github.com/rust-lang/rust/pull/126733. The implementation changed substantially in LLVM 19, and there are no plans to support both the LLVM 18 and LLVM 19 implementation at the same time.

Compatibility note for wasm:

> WebAssembly target support for the `multivalue` target feature has changed when upgrading to LLVM 19. Support for generating functions with multiple returns no longer works and `-Ctarget-feature=+multivalue` has a different meaning than it did in LLVM 18 and prior. The WebAssembly target features `multivalue` and `reference-types` are now both enabled by default, but generated code is not affected by default. These features being enabled are encoded in the `target_features` custom section and may affect downstream tooling such as `wasm-opt` consuming the module, but the actual generated WebAssembly will continue to not use either `multivalue` or `reference-types` by default. There is no longer any supported means to generate a module that has a function with multiple returns.
